The global patient administration system market size was valued at USD 777.57 million in 2024 and is projected to grow from USD 846.64 million in 2025 to reach USD 1,399.21 million by 2033, exhibiting a CAGR of 6.5% during the forecast period (2025-2033).
A Patient Administration System (PAS) is a digital solution used in healthcare facilities to manage patient-related administrative tasks efficiently. It streamlines processes such as patient registration, appointment scheduling, medical record management, billing, and discharge procedures. PAS enhances hospital workflow by reducing paperwork, minimizing errors, and improving communication between departments. By integrating with electronic health records (EHR) and other healthcare IT systems, PAS ensures seamless data management, better patient care coordination, and compliance with regulatory standards.

The adoption of patient administration systems requires a significant upfront investment in IT infrastructure, hardware, and software, making it a financial challenge for many healthcare providers. Beyond initial setup costs, ongoing expenses for system upgrades, cybersecurity measures, staff training, and regulatory compliance further increase the financial burden.
Small and mid-sized healthcare facilities, often operating under tight budget constraints, struggle to transition from legacy systems to advanced digital models. Moreover, integrating PAS with existing Electronic Health Records (EHR) and hospital management systems can be complex and costly, making affordability a major barrier to widespread adoption.

North America holds a dominant position in the global patient administration system market, driven by a well-established healthcare IT infrastructure, widespread adoption of digital health solutions, and significant investments in AI-powered healthcare management systems. Government policies, such as the Health Information Technology for Economic and Clinical Health (HITECH) Act, mandate the adoption of EHRs, fostering market growth. Moreover, the presence of key healthcare IT manufacturers, favorable reimbursement policies, and rising integration of AI and cloud-based solutions enhance system efficiency, ensuring continuous advancements in patient administration technology across the region.
Asia-Pacific is expected to witness the fastest CAGR, propelled by increasing healthcare digitization, rising government investments in health IT, and widespread adoption of cloud-based technologies. The growing demand for automated patient administration solutions is fueled by the expansion of healthcare infrastructure and a rising burden of chronic diseases. Countries like China, India, and Japan are leading this growth through initiatives in AI-based healthcare, telemedicine, and nationwide EHR implementation. With rapid urbanization, increasing healthcare expenditure, and a focus on digital transformation, Asia-Pacific remains a key driver of market expansion.

The software segment leads the market for patient administration system as healthcare providers increasingly adopt AI-powered and cloud-based hospital management solutions. These systems enhance efficiency, reduce costs, and improve patient care. In September 2024, SMARTHMS & Solutions Private Limited launched an upgraded hospital management software, cutting operational costs by 30%, increasing doctor mobility by 70%, and improving nursing efficiency by 50%. With AI-driven inventory, finance, and patient management features, software remains at the core of digital healthcare transformation.
Cloud-based solutions dominate the global market due to their scalability, cost-effectiveness, and seamless integration with healthcare IT systems. They reduce reliance on on-premise infrastructure while ensuring secure, real-time data sharing. In March 2023, Fujitsu launched a cloud-based healthcare platform in Japan, enabling secure aggregation and analysis of electronic medical records (EMRs) using HL7 FHIR standards. This enhances data interoperability, remote access, and AI-driven analytics, reinforcing cloud solutions as the backbone of digital transformation in healthcare.
